M.I.A. – Bad Girls (Self Released)
4/5
With M.I.A. releasing her new Vicki Leekx mix tape as a free download, its aim presumably being to rebuild broken barriers after what can be called a difficult 2010, lead cut ‘Bad Girls’ signals that she’s entering 2011 with a fresh new outlook. Despite a troubled last year, M.I.A.’s ability as a songwriter and performer, ever growing skill in music production and knack for combining a variety of genres clearly hasn’t left her entirely.
‘Bad Girls’, as we should expect, finds M.I.A. speaking her mind. And though on last year’s /\/\/\Y/\ some of that vitriol was lost in the muddy production, this could be the start of a return to form – the message here (“live fast, die young, bad girls do it well!”) is never lost despite being part of a huge array of sounds that range from Missy Elliott-influenced hip hop to Indian Bangra.
